Sodium carboxymethyl cellulose, derived from cellulose, is a water-soluble polymer, which plays a pivotal role as a thickener, emulsifier, and stabilizer. With its high viscosity and non-toxic nature, it is a preferred choice among food technologists aiming to improve product quality. In the dairy industry, for instance, CMC is instrumental in maintaining the desired consistency of ice creams and yogurt by preventing the formation of ice crystals, resulting in a smooth and creamy texture consumed by millions across the globe. Its application extends beyond dairy; in bakery products, sodium CMC enhances moisture retention and dough uniformity, contributing to a delectable crumb texture in bread and cakes. The additive’s hygroscopic properties ensure extended freshness and palatability, aligning with consumer demands for longer-lasting, high-quality food items. The application of CMC in gluten-free baking is particularly noteworthy, as it compensates for the absence of gluten, encouraging structure and elasticity reminiscent of traditional baked goods.

Sodium carboxymethyl cellulose is also celebrated for its role in reducing fat content without compromising mouthfeel, making it an invaluable additive in the production of low-fat and vegan alternatives. Its stabilizing properties are beneficial in plant-based milk, where it helps in achieving a homogenous mixture, free from separation. The expertise surrounding the utilization of CMC is embedded in its safe consumption levels, as regulated by food safety authorities globally. The Joint FAO/WHO Expert Committee on Food Additives recognizes its harmless profile when used within prescribed limits.
